A cubic mile is an imperial / U.S. customary (non-SI non-metric) unit of volume, used in the United States. It is defined as the volume of a cube with sides of 1 mile (5280 feet, 1760 yards, ≈1.609 kilometre) in length.

Symbols


There is no universally agreed symbol but the following are used:
  • cubic mile
  • cu mile
  • cu mi
  • mile/-3
  • mi/-3
  • mile^3
  • mi^3
  • mile³
  • mi³

Conversions

1 cubic mile is equivalent to:
  • 1,101,117,140,000 U.S. liquid gallons
  • ≈26,217,074,761.905 crude barrels
  • 4,168,181,825,440.579584 litres (exactly)
